The Advanced Certificate in Fisheries Economics for Food Insecurity is a comprehensive course designed to address the global challenge of food insecurity through sustainable fisheries management. This program emphasizes the importance of economic principles, policies, and tools in managing fisheries sustainably and alleviating food insecurity.

About this course

Learners will gain essential skills in fisheries economics, policy analysis, market mechanisms, and resource management, preparing them for careers in government, non-profit, and private sectors. With the increasing demand for sustainable food systems and the need for experts in fisheries economics, this course offers a timely and relevant curriculum. Learners will be equipped with the skills to analyze fisheries data, evaluate economic and policy impacts, and develop innovative solutions to food insecurity. By completing this course, learners will demonstrate their expertise in fisheries economics and their commitment to sustainable food systems, positioning themselves for career advancement and impact in this critical field.
